Dela via


Så här skapar du ett all inclusive-distributionspaket för Internet Explorer 11

Varning

Supporten har upphört för det indragna skrivbordsprogrammet Internet Explorer 11 och det har inaktiveras permanent via en Microsoft Edge-uppdatering för vissa versioner av Windows 10. Mer information finns i Vanliga frågor och svar om indragning av skrivbordsprogrammet Internet Explorer 11.

I den här artikeln beskrivs hur du skapar ett installationspaket för Internet Explorer 11. Installationspaketet kan tillämpa alla nödvändiga uppdateringar, språkpaket och stavningsordlistor samt de senaste kumulativa säkerhetsuppdateringarna i en enda omstart.

Ursprunglig produktversion: Internet Explorer 11
Ursprungligt KB-nummer: 3061428

Sammanfattning

Följande anpassade lösning tillhandahålls som den är. Det kan ge en funktionell lösning för kunder som behöver den här funktionen. Med tanke på det unika i varje kundmiljö ger Microsoft inga garantier för att dessa procedurer uppfyller kundens mål. De som implementerar dessa procedurer uppmanas starkt att noggrant testa procedurerna innan de distribuerar dem till en produktionsmiljö.

Procedurerna i den här artikeln kräver att kunden är bekant med att skapa batchfiler (.bat), kommandoradsgränssnittet och arbeta med 32- och 64-bitars Windows-operativsystem.

Tips

Alla nödvändiga resurspaket kan hämtas från webbplatsen för Microsoft Update Catalog.

Slutför varje avsnitt helt innan du fortsätter.

Internet Explorer 11 nödvändiga paket

  1. Skapa en tillfällig mapp med namnet Temp i roten på enhet C och se till att det finns minst 500 MB ledigt diskutrymme.

  2. Genom att använda KB-2847882 som referens laddar du ned de enskilda paketen för lämplig Windows CPU-plattform (x64 eller x86) där Internet Explorer 11 kommer att distribueras. Spara dessa paket i den temporära katalog som du skapade i steg 1.

  3. I mappen Temp skapar du en ny mapp med namnet Cabfiles.

  4. I en administrativ kommandotolk ändrar du till mappen C:Temp .

  5. Extrahera innehållet i varje .msu-kravpaket till Cabfiles mappen med hjälp av följande syntax:

    C:\temp>expand "Windows6.1-KB2731771-x64.msu" -f:* c:\temp\cabfiles
    

Obs!

Följande kommandoradsexempel används för att extrahera x64-versionen av nödvändiga uppdateringar i Internet Explorer 11. (Om du vill bearbeta x86-versionen av komponenten ersätter du paketnamnet x64 (.msu) med paketnamnet x86 (.msu).)

Skärmbild som visar kommandoutdata för att extrahera uppdateringar av krav för Internet Explorer 11.

Upprepa dessa steg för att extrahera alla krav för Internet Explorer 11 och spara .cab-filerna i C:\Temp\Cabfiles mappen.

Internet Explorer 11-kärninstallationspaket

  1. Ladda ned de grundläggande Internet Explorer 11-installationspaketen som behövs för Windows-målplattformen och spara paketen i mappen C:\Temp .

  2. I en administrativ kommandotolk ändrar du till mappen C:\Temp .

  3. Extrahera innehållet i kärnpaketen i Internet Explorer 11 till Cabfiles mappen med hjälp av följande syntax:

    C:\temp>IE 11-windows6.1-x64-en-us.exe /x:c:\temp\cabfiles
    

Obs!

Följande kommandoradsexempel används för att extrahera en x64-version av installationspaketet för Internet Explorer 11 Core. (Om du vill bearbeta x86-versionen av komponenten ersätter du x64-paketnamnet med x86-paketnamnet.)

Skärmbild som visar kommandot för att extrahera Installationspaketet för Internet Explorer 11 Core.

IE-Win7.cab är namnet på den .cab fil som extraheras från Installationsfilen för Internet Explorer 11 (IE11-Windows6.1-x64-en-us.exe). Den sparas i C:\Temp\Cabfiles mappen .

Internet Explorer 11 språkpaket

Obs!

Innan du installerar språkpaketen för Internet Explorer 11 måste du installera operativsystemets språkpaket för motsvarande språk i Internet Explorer 11. Du kan ladda ned och installera detta via Windows Uppdateringar eller manuellt.

Om du till exempel vill installera det franska språkpaketet för Internet Explorer 11 måste vi redan ha det franska os-språkpaketet installerat på datorn. Mer information finns i Språkpaket för Windows.

  1. Ladda ned språkpaketen för Internet Explorer 11 och spara dem i mappen C:\temp .

  2. I en administrativ kommandotolk ändrar du till mappen C:\Temp .

  3. Extrahera innehållet i språkpaketen i Internet Explorer 11 till Cabfiles mappen med hjälp av följande syntax:

    C:\temp>Expand "IE11-windows6.1-LanguagePack-x64.af-za.msu" -f:* c:\temp\cabfiles
    

Obs!

Namnet på det nedladdade språkpaketet för Internet Explorer 11 är IE11-Windows6.1-LanguagePack-x64-af-za.msu.
Utdata .cab fil: "Windows6.1-KB2841134-X64.cab."

Alla extraherade språkpaketfiler har samma namn (till exempel Windows6.1-KB2841134-X64.cab). Därför måste du se till att du byter namn på de .cab filerna så att de inte skrivs över om du extraherar fler än ett språkpaket till samma plats.

Byt till exempel namn på de extraherade .cab-filerna på följande sätt:

Språkpaket Gammalt namn Nytt namn
Språkpaket 1 Windows6.1-KB2841134-X64.cab Windows6.1-KB2841134-X64-Af-za.cab
Språkpaket 2 Windows6.1-KB2841134-X64.cab Windows6.1-KB2841134-X64-fr-fr.cab

: Från "Windows6.1-KB2841134-X64.cab" till "Windows6.1-KB2841134-X64-Af-za.cab"
: Från "Windows6.1-KB2841134-X64.cab" till "Windows6.1-KB2841134-X64-fr-fr.cab"

Följande kommandoradsexempel används för att extrahera en x64-version av språkpaketet Afrikaans. (Om du vill bearbeta x86-versionen av komponenten ersätter du x64-paketnamnet med x86-paketnamnet.)

Skärmbild som visar kommandoutdata för att extrahera Internet Explorer 11-språkpaketet.

Internet Explorer 11 stavningsordlistor

  1. Ladda ned Internet Explorer 11-paketen för stavningsordlista och spara dem i mappen C:\Temp .

  2. I en administrativ kommandotolk ändrar du till mappen C:\Temp .

  3. Extrahera innehållet i stavningsordlistans paket till Cabfiles mappen med hjälp av följande syntax:

    C:\temp>Expand "IE-Spelling-fr.msu" -f:* c:\temp\cabfiles
    

Obs!

Följande kommandoradsexempel används för att extrahera x64- eller x86-versionen av paketet Stavningsordlistor.

Skärmbild som visar kommandoutdata för att extrahera Internet Explorer 11 Spelling Dictionary-paketet.

Internet Explorer 11 kumulativ säkerhetsuppdatering

  1. Ladda ned de senaste CSU-paketen (Internet Explorer 11 Cumulative Security Update) och spara dem i mappen C:\Temp .

  2. I en administrativ kommandotolk ändrar du till mappen C:\Temp .

  3. Extrahera innehållet i Paketen för kumulativ säkerhetsuppdatering i Internet Explorer 11 till Cabfiles mappen med hjälp av följande syntax:

    C:\temp>Expand "IE11-Windows6.1-KB3049563-x64.msu" -f:* c:\temp\cabfiles
    

Obs!

Följande kommandoradsexempel används för att extrahera x64-versionen av Internet Explorer 11 Cumulative Security Uppdateringar. (Om du vill bearbeta x86-versionen av komponenten ersätter du x64-paketnamnet med x86-paketnamnet.)

Skärmbild som visar kommandoutdata för att extrahera Internet Explorer 11 CSU.

Slutför paketet

När du har följt alla föregående steg kan du använda C:\Temp\Cabfiles mappen som källa för installationen av Internet Explorer 11-kraven, installationsfilerna för Internet Explorer 11 core, språkpaketen, stavningsordlistorna och den senaste kumulativa säkerhetsuppdateringen. Du kan sedan använda en batchfil för att starta installationen av varje komponent i följd.

Kopiera följande exempelskript till Anteckningar och anpassa det baserat på paketkraven. Paketkraven omfattar följande:

  • Installationspaket för Internet Explorer (x86 eller x64)
  • Språkpaket
  • Stavningsordlistepaket
  • Kumulativa säkerhetsuppdateringar

Spara sedan skriptfilen som SampleScript.bat i C:\Temp\Cabfiles mappen så att den har åtkomst till alla filer i mappen.

Till exempel: C:\Temp\Cabfiles\SampleScript.bat

Så fort du anpassar och sparar skriptfilen bör du dubbelklicka påSamplescript.bat för att köra den. Ett kommandotolksfönster visar de kommandon som körs av skriptet. Utdata liknar följande:

Skärmbild som visar Samplescript.bat skriptutdata.

Det här skriptet installerar alla extraherade .cab-filer utan en uppmaning om att starta om. Dessa filer innehåller krav för Internet Explorer 11, Internet Explorer 11-installationsfilen, språkpaketet Internet Explorer 11, stavningspaketet Internet Explorer 11 och den kumulativa säkerhetsuppdateringen Internet Explorer 11.

Så snart Samplescript.bat-filen installerar alla cab-filer startar du om datorn manuellt.

Exempelskript för att installera x64-versionen av .cab-filerna

Obs!

Syntaxen i följande skript förblir i princip densamma för installation av x86 (32-bitars) Internet Explorer 11. Den enda ändring som krävs är att ersätta alla x64-bitars cab-filnamn med x86 cab-filnamn.

ECHO OFF
ECHO Installing IE 11 prerequisite: KB2834140
dism /online /add-package /packagepath:Windows6.1-KB2834140-v2-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2670838
dism /online /add-package /packagepath:Windows6.1-KB2670838-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2639308
dism /online /add-package /packagepath:Windows6.1-KB2639308-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2533623
dism /online /add-package /packagepath:Windows6.1-KB2533623-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2731771
dism /online /add-package /packagepath:Windows6.1-KB2731771-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2729094
dism /online /add-package /packagepath:Windows6.1-KB2729094-v2-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2786081
dism /online /add-package /packagepath:Windows6.1-KB2786081-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2888049
dism /online /add-package /packagepath:Windows6.1-KB2888049-x64.cab /quiet /norestart
ECHO Installing IE 11 prerequisite: KB2882822
dism /online /add-package /packagepath:Windows6.1-KB2882822-x64.cab /quiet /norestart
ECHO Installing IE 11 Main Application
dism /online /add-package /packagepath:IE-Win7.cab /quiet /norestart
ECHO Installing IE 11 Spanish language Pack
dism /online /add-package /packagepath:Windows6.1-KB2841134-x64-es.cab /quiet /norestart
ECHO Installing IE 11 language French pack
dism /online /add-package /packagepath:Windows6.1-KB2841134-x64-fr-fr.cab /quiet /norestart
ECHO Installing IE 11 French Spelling Dictionaries Pack
dism /online /add-package /packagepath:Windows6.3-KB2849696-x86.cab /quiet /norestart
ECHO Installing IE cumulative security update
dism /online /add-package /package path: IE11-Windows6.1-KB3049563-x64.cab /quiet /norestart

Viktigt

Det här är en exempelskriptfil som tillhandahålls som en demonstration för att uppnå det scenario som diskuterades tidigare. Vi tillhandahåller inga garantier eller stöd för den här skriptfilen. Du bör testa skriptfilen noggrant innan du provar den i produktionsmiljöer.

Mer information

Dessa procedurer kan endast tillämpas på följande operativsystem:

  • Windows 7 (32-bitars och 64-bitarsversioner) Service Pack 1
  • Windows Server 2008 R2 (64-bitars version) Service Pack 1

Mer information om de lägsta operativsystemkraven för Internet Explorer 11 finns i Systemkrav och språkstöd för Internet Explorer 11 (IE11).